区域识别的方法、装置、终端和计算机可读存储介质与流程

文档序号:19787067发布日期:2020-01-24 13:43阅读:来源:国知局

技术特征:

1.一种区域识别的方法,其特征在于,包括:

根据路网数据将指定地区切分为多个区块;

根据需要识别的区域类型,对所述指定地区的打点数据进行筛选;

将筛选出的所述打点数据聚类;

根据聚类结果从多个所述区块中获取与所述区域类型对应的目标区域;

根据筛选出的所述打点数据,识别出所述目标区域的边界。

2.如权利要求1所述的方法,其特征在于,根据路网数据将指定地区切分为多个区块,包括:

从所述指定地区的路网数据中确定出多个切分道路;

对各所述切分道路进行线段聚合,将所述指定地区切分成多个所述区块。

3.如权利要求1所述的方法,其特征在于,将筛选出的所述打点数据聚类,包括:

通过密度聚类算法对筛选出的所述打点数据进行聚类,并生成所述聚类结果。

4.如权利要求1所述的方法,其特征在于,还包括:

根据需要识别的所述区域类型,对所述指定地区的兴趣点进行筛选;

对筛选出的所述兴趣点与所述目标区域进行关系判断和距离计算,得到与所述目标区域相关联的兴趣点。

5.如权利要求4所述的方法,其特征在于,对筛选出的所述兴趣点与所述目标区域进行关系判断和距离计算,得到与所述目标区域相关联的兴趣点,包括:

若一个兴趣点位于所述目标区域的边界内,则判定为所述相关联的兴趣点;

若一个兴趣点位于所述目标区域的所述边界周围,则计算所述兴趣点与所述区域的所述边界之间的距离,若所述距离在阈值范围内,则判定为所述相关联的兴趣点。

6.如权利要求4所述的方法,其特征在于,还包括:

根据所述相关联的兴趣点,获取所述目标区域的区域信息。

7.一种区域识别的装置,其特征在于,包括:

切分模块,用于根据路网数据将指定地区切分为多个区块;

第一筛选模块,用于根据需要识别的区域类型,对所述指定地区的打点数据进行筛选;

聚类模块,用于将筛选出的所述打点数据聚类;

区域类型识别模块,用于根据聚类结果从多个所述区块中获取所述区域类型对应的目标区域;

区域边界识别模块,用于根据筛选出的所述打点数据,识别出所述目标区域的边界。

8.如权利要求7所述的装置,其特征在于,所述切分模块包括:

道路选择子模块,用于从所述指定地区的路网数据中确定出多个切分道路;

切分子模块,用于对各所述切分道路进行线段聚合,将所述指定地区切分成多个所述区块。

9.如权利要求7所述的装置,其特征在于,还包括:

第二筛选模块,用于根据所述区域类型,对所述指定地区的兴趣点进行筛选;

处理模块,用于对筛选出的所述兴趣点与所述目标区域进行关系判断和距离计算,得到与所述目标区域相关联的兴趣点。

10.如权利要求9所述的装置,其特征在于,处理模块包括:

判断子模块,用于判断若一个兴趣点位于所述目标区域的边界内,则判定为所述相关联的兴趣点;若一个兴趣点位于所述目标区域的所述边界周围,则计算所述兴趣点与所述区域的所述边界之间的距离,若所述距离在阈值范围内,则判定为所述相关联的兴趣点。

11.一种区域识别的终端,其特征在于,包括:

一个或多个处理器;

存储装置,用于存储一个或多个程序;

当所述一个或多个程序被所述一个或多个处理器执行时,使得所述一个或多个处理器实现如权利要求1至6中任一项所述的方法。

12.一种计算机可读存储介质,其存储有计算机程序,其特征在于,该程序被处理器执行时实现如权利要求1至6中任一项所述的方法。

当前第2页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1